A water-chiller refrigeration ton is defined as: 1 Refrigeration Ton (RT) = 1 TONS cond = 12000 Btu /h = 200 Btu /min = 3025.9 k Calories /h = 12661 kJ/h = 3.517 kW . 1 kW = 0.2843 Refrigeration Ton (RT) A ton is the amount of heat removed by an air conditioning system that would melt 1 ton (2000 lbs.) of ice in 24 hours. If you know how these two sizes relate ...The right HVAC piston size for a heat pump or AC coil is determined by the tonnage of the coil, from 1.5 to 5 tons. Whether the system is R22 or R410A also makes a difference. The piston orifice size for R22 refrigerant systems is larger than for R410A systems. This HVAC Heat Load Calculator will help you estimate proper system size in BTUs/h, base on simplified Manual-J method, that accounts for your home size, heat loss, geographic/regional adjustments, etc., to give you a pretty accurate size of you cooling/heating ...Tonnage: In reference to air conditioning, a ton measures how much heat removed by the system would be needed to melt 2,000 pounds, or one ton, of ice in a 24-hour period. The result is then expressed in BTUs per hour. According to the standard calculation, it takes 288,000 BTUs to melt a ton of ice in 24 hours, or 12,000 BTUs per hour.An air conditioner generally needs about 20 BTU per square foot of living space. Once you've calculated the square footage of the room or home, multiply the result by 20 to find the air conditioner size for the home.
